True. But if you ask me, using a Wankel engine for this purpose is like going two steps forward but one step back. It does benefit from a more silent vehicle, but the inefficiency would undoubtedly go against what all these going green and going electric trend are trying to promote.
Asked why Mazda will use a rotary engine as a range-extender, Hitomi said: “the rotary engine isn’t particularly efficient to use as a range-extender but when we turn on a rotary, it is much, much quieter compared to other manufacturers’ range-extenders”, which is seemingly suited to the near silence of electric cars.
